Abstract
This paper presents the results of a study developed in organizations located in the metropolitan region of Belo Horizonte, in Minas Gerais state. The research aimed to evaluate: (a) the information systems (IS) used by the organizations; (b) the information provided by the IS; and (c) the satisfaction of the IS’s users. The study was based on a questionnaire applied to 335 users of several IS’s at 161 different companies. The following techniques were used to analyze the data: (i) descriptive statistics; (ii) exploratory factor analysis; (iii) Kolmogorov- -Smirnov test; (iv) analysis of variance (ANOVA); and (v) the Tukey test. It was found that the users evaluated every analyzed attribute of the IS’s, and the information provided by them, as “good”. Moreover, the users most satisfied with the IS usually responded positively to the attributes evaluated.
